Works perfectly. Outstanding sound quality.

My TV's 3.5mm stereo audio output was defective and I needed a way to connect the TV to my 1990's stereo amplifier, which only has analog inputs. I plugged it into the optical output and changed my Samsung TV's audio output to PCM with Bitstream and it worked straight away. Make sure to adjust the audio delay in your TV's advanced settings to keep the audio in sync with the video. I still use the VCR from time to time and was concerned that my coax connection to the TV wasn't outputting sound through the optical digital out, but that worked! If the output volume is low at first, turn the volume wheel on the side. Turning it on to the max fixed it.
